小程序开发是近年来非常流行的一种技术,它允许开发者在微信等社交平台上快速构建并发布应用程序。掌握小程序开发对于希望进入移动应用开发领域的开发者来说至关重要。以下是一些高效学习策略,帮助快速掌握小程序开发:
1. 理解小程序的基本概念和框架
- 学习小程序的官方文档,了解其基本功能、API接口以及运行机制。
- 阅读相关书籍或在线课程,如《微信小程序开发实战》等,以获得更深入的理解。
2. 学习编程语言基础
- 熟悉JavaScript语言,因为小程序主要使用JavaScript进行开发。
- 学习常见的前端开发工具,如WebStorm、Visual Studio Code等,这些工具有助于提高开发效率。
3. 掌握小程序开发环境
- 安装并熟练使用微信开发者工具,这是开发小程序必不可少的工具。
- 学习如何使用模拟器(如真机模拟器)来测试小程序的功能。
4. 实践编程技能
- 通过实际项目来练习,可以从简单的小项目开始,逐步增加复杂度。
- 参与开源项目或社区贡献,这可以帮助你在实际项目中学习和成长。
5. 学习设计原则
- 理解用户体验设计(UX Design)和用户界面设计(UI Design)的原则,这对于制作易用且吸引人的小程序至关重要。
- 学习响应式设计和跨平台设计,确保你的小程序能够在不同的设备上良好运行。
6. 关注行业动态和技术趋势
- 定期阅读相关新闻、博客和论坛,了解最新的小程序开发技术和工具。
- 参加线上或线下的技术研讨会和讲座,与同行交流经验。
7. 建立良好的编码习惯
- 编写可维护的代码,遵循模块化、封装和复用的编程原则。
- 使用版本控制工具,如Git,来管理代码的版本和协作。
8. 学习项目管理
- 学习如何规划项目,包括需求分析、设计、开发、测试和维护阶段。
- 了解敏捷开发方法,如Scrum或Kanban,以提高开发效率和团队协作。
9. 持续学习
- 不断更新自己的知识库,通过在线课程、教程和书籍来扩展技能。
- 加入相关的学习小组或社群,与其他开发者交流心得和解决问题。
10. 实际应用所学知识
- 尝试将所学知识应用于实际项目中,通过实践来巩固和深化理解。
- 参与开源项目,或者自己发起项目,这样可以在实践中学习和成长。
通过上述策略,你可以系统地学习小程序开发,从基础知识到高级技巧,再到实际项目的实践经验,逐步提高自己的技能水平。总之,学习是一个持续的过程,保持好奇心和积极的学习态度是成功的关键。